what is a moment connection and shear connection ? where it
provided ? why it provided ?

Answer Posted / prashant karanjekar

It is term referring to the bending & rotating effect of an
eccentric force upon a member or joint is called
moment.when force is coming on the body towards against &
opposite each other is called shear.In shear connection
top & bottom flange of the connecting member is not welded
to the connected member & in moment conection top & bottom
flange of the connecting member is welded to the connected
member.
when more load is not coming on the connection that time
member can be rotate clockwise or counterclockwise so there
moment conection used.
